Output 012bfb7043bb65ed0fe3902c30dc8540dc93e7894d21c59bd9804b7899f4abac:1

value
1083004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d043eace5a391af3d978b683986c622c61c6b63a OP_EQUAL
address
3LgDqR2TdwQvVCprM7sxAoXRSmc22z7RYz
transaction
012bfb7043bb65ed0fe3902c30dc8540dc93e7894d21c59bd9804b7899f4abac
spent
true